Adds confirm-before-sent: a payment is not shown as "sent" until the relay
actually confirms receipt. If the path is slow or a send doesn't land, you now
see a clear "not confirmed — retry" instead of a false "sent" that quietly loses
the payment.
Routing is unchanged from prior builds: all wallet nostr traffic — slatepacks,
payment requests, identity, discovery, goblin.st name + relay lookups — rides
the mixnet; the grin node and price/fiat lookups stay direct.
Connect reliability, measured before release:
- Cold start: the wallet races two mixnet entry-gateway connects and takes the
first up, so a dead random draw no longer costs the full timeout (dead-round
rate drops from p to p^2; verified across 30 cold trials).
- Dead exits are condemned in ~10s instead of ~32s (fresh-tunnel probe budget
5s x 2 rounds, 4.2x margin over the worst measured healthy probe), removing
the 50-70s worst-case connects. Established-tunnel keepalive unchanged.
- "Connecting relays..." clears in ~2-4s after saving the relay list (the
Connected flag now tracks the real relay-up signal instead of waiting on a
30s catch-up fetch); identity publishes are time-boxed; the onboarding
Claim button un-gates equally sooner.
- Gateway-race and probe timings are now visible in [timing] logs.

Bugfix: the mixnet exit-liveness probe now races two stable targets over two
rounds instead of a single one-shot 1.1.1.1 connect, so a healthy tunnel is no
longer false-condemned and reselected forever. Fixes the intermittent
Connecting to Nym hangs that could take minutes or never resolve (verified:
15/15 cold starts connected, zero hangs).
Also: the Android versionCode/versionName now track the Goblin build number
(were frozen at GRIM's 5 / "0.3.6"), so the OS detects upgrades correctly.
Bugfix: the default and fallback messaging relay moved from relay.goblin.st
(being retired) to relay.floonet.dev, so new installs and reconnects use the
live relay. Built-in relay fallback list updated to match.
